Job Cost Accuracy
The precision with which a company estimates and tracks the costs associated with specific jobs or projects.
Overhead Cost Driver
A factor that causes the cost of overheads to change, such as machine hours or labor hours.
Predetermined Overhead Rate
A rate estimated before a period begins, used to allocate overhead costs to products or job orders based on a chosen activity base.
Allocation Base
A measure of activity such as direct labor-hours or machine-hours that is used to assign costs to cost objects.
